Abstract
Cymothoa hermani sp. nov., a buccal fish-parasitic isopod is described from off Unguja Island, Zanzibar, from the buccal cavity of the marbled parrotfish, Leptoscarus vaigiensis. Cymothoa hermani sp. nov. is characterised by the unique bulbous ornamentation on pereonite 1, anterolateral angles on pereonite 1 rounded and produced past frontal margin of cephalon, and pereopods with long and slender dactyli. There are no other species of Cymothoa known from parrotfishes. This description increases the number of known Cymothoa from the southwestern Indian Ocean to four.
